Syllabus Guidelines

Southern Association of Colleges and Schools (S.A.C.S.) requires that all syllabi of proposed courses be reviewed for the essentials. Based on the review, a decision is made about whether graduate credit should be awarded for the proposed course, how many hours of graduate credit should be awarded for the proposed course, and whether a grade will be awarded or pass/fail will be assigned for the proposed course.

New "No child Left Behind Act" Syllabus Implications Scientifically or Research Based Information: Beginning in 2004 the N.C.L.B. Act will start requiring a report from each state on how scientific or research based goals, objectives, and course content is being included as part of professional development course work. Obviously, this action will result in school districts being asked for information on how this criterion is being addressed in Professional Development course syllabi.
